1. Surti Locho

Surti Locho is the most famous food of Surat. Made from gram flour and steamed to a soft texture, it’s topped with butter, sev, chutneys, and spices.
Soft, spicy, and slightly tangy Locho perfectly represents Surti taste.
2. Surti Sev Khamani

Sev Khamani is a popular breakfast and evening snack in Surat. It’s made from crumbled chana dal, mixed with spices, and garnished with sev and pomegranate.
Light, flavorful, and addictive a true Surti classic.
3. Undhiyu

Undhiyu is a traditional Gujarati dish but Surat-style Undhiyu has its own charm. Cooked slowly with seasonal vegetables and spices, it’s rich and comforting.
Best enjoyed with puri and shrikhand.
4. Ghari

Ghari is the signature sweet of Surat. Made with mawa, ghee, sugar, and dry fruits, it’s especially popular during festivals.
If you visit Surat and don’t try Ghari, your trip is incomplete.
5. Fafda Jalebi

This classic Gujarati breakfast is extremely popular in Surat. Crispy fafda paired with hot, juicy jalebi creates the perfect sweet-and-salty balance.
Locals enjoy it early in the morning with papaya sambharo and chutney.
6. Ponk Vada

Available only in winter, Ponk Vada is made from tender sorghum grains (ponk). It’s a seasonal Surti specialty that food lovers wait for all year.
Crispy outside, soft inside truly unique.
7. Surti Khichdi

Surti Khichdi is simple yet comforting. Made with rice, lentils, and mild spices, it’s often served with kadhi, ghee, and papad.
Perfect for a light and satisfying meal.
8. Bhajiya

Surat is famous for its variety of bhajiyas onion, potato, spinach, and more. Especially loved during monsoons, bhajiyas are crunchy, spicy, and filling.
Best paired with green chutney and hot tea.
9. Ice Gola

In Surat’s heat, Ice Gola is a favorite street dessert. Crushed ice soaked in colorful flavored syrups makes it refreshing and fun.
Popular flavors include kala khatta, rose, and mango.
10. Dabeli

Dabeli is one of the most loved street foods in Surat. Filled with spicy potato mixture, peanuts, sev, and chutneys, it’s bursting with flavor in every bite.
Affordable, tasty, and perfect for quick hunger.
